Soon after he escapes prison and steals Rachel away from the asylum, the two flee to another country to safety. Despite everything looking up for the two of them, it things are not all as they seem. Apparently another building just like the one the two had escaped from exists in this new country, and they stole Zack away from Rachel, leaving her with little to no recollection of him. At this place, Zack is the sacrifice, and wanting to hurry out and find Rachel for her sake and his, he teams up with you, as he could not figure much out on his own. Throughout the time that the two of you spend together, you seem to form much more of an unbreakable bond to where Zack's kills start to be for you and only you.
